Crookston’s Reggie Winjum signs to play Basketball at UMC

Crookston High School senior Reggie Winjum signed a National Letter of Intent to play basketball at the University of Minnesota Crookston next year. Winjum is following the footsteps of his sister Halle Winjum, who currently plays for the Golden Eagle Women’s program. Crookston Pirate Boys Basketball struggles on the boards in loss to EGF

The East Grand Forks Green Wave dominated the glass and pulled away in the second half to beat the Crookston Pirate Boys Basketball team 94-58 in a Section 8AA game played at the East Grand Forks Senior High School gymnasium. Crookston Pirate Boys Basketball comes up short in loss to DGF in Section 8AA tourney

With the game tied at 61-61, the Dilworth-Glyndon-Felton Rebels went on a 14-0 run to beat the Crookston Pirate Boys Basketball team 59-51 in the Section 8AA tournament first-round game played at Dilworth-Glyndon-Felton High School in Glyndon. Kittson Co. Central uses big first half to beat Crookston Boys Basketball

The Kittson County Central Bearcats outscored the Crookston Pirate Boys Basketball team 33-14 in the first half on their way to a 67-50 victory in the regular season finale for both teams in a game played at the Kittson Central High School gymnasium in Hallock. Crookston Boys Boys Basketball pulls away for a big win over Bagley

The Crookston Pirate Boys Basketball team used a strong transition attack and stifling defense to knock off the Bagley Flyers 80-43 Thursday evening in Bagley.
